Data flow: CELUM ? OpenText Extended ECM Platform
Marketing teams create, review, and approve digital assets in CELUM, then publish final approved versions to OpenText Extended ECM Platform as governed business records. This ensures that brand-approved assets, campaign masters, and final deliverables are retained with enterprise records management, retention policies, and auditability.
Data flow: Bi-directional
CELUM manages asset rights, usage restrictions, and approval status, while OpenText Extended ECM Platform stores related contracts, licensing agreements, and approval documentation. Integration links each asset to its governing legal documents so marketing and compliance teams can verify usage rights before publishing or reusing content.

Data flow: Bi-directional
CELUM manages the active lifecycle of creative assets during production, review, and distribution. Once assets are retired, OpenText Extended ECM Platform takes over long-term retention, archival, and disposition management. This creates a clear handoff between operational content management and enterprise records governance.
Data flow: Bi-directional metadata synchronization
Metadata from CELUM assets and OpenText Extended ECM Platform business documents is synchronized to enable unified search across marketing and enterprise content. Users can find campaign assets, approvals, contracts, and supporting documents without switching systems, improving productivity for marketing, procurement, legal, and sales teams.
